Transaction 21875b70f18707338e4ddb9229311c20627b7620a620f29efd48ec5c38a6427b
1 Input
1 Output
-
21875b70f18707338e4ddb9229311c20627b7620a620f29efd48ec5c38a6427b:0
- value
- 403912635
- script pubkey
- OP_0 OP_PUSHBYTES_20 70a85c714ba538d4765d11e4541d090b05a36dcd
- address
- bc1qwz59cu2t55udgajaz8j9g8gfpvz6xmwdp8ec2m